N a parking lot of 240 red and blue cars, the ratio of red cars to blue cars is 3 : 5. How many red cars are in the parking lot?

So lets add 3+5 to get 8.

So we know that 240/8 is 30

now multiply 3 and 5 by 30

so if 3 represents red you should get 90 cars

Check:

   3=90

 +5=150

----------------

   8=240

so the final answer is 90 red cars
